Types of Window Locks

Window lock specialists work with a range of locking systems to match different kinds of windows and security requirements. A few of the most common types include:

  1. Casement Locks: These locks are usually utilized on casement windows, which open outward like a door. They secure the window by locking the sash to the frame.
  2. Double-Hung Locks: Designed for double-hung windows, these locks are set up on the meeting rail and protect the window by pulling the sashes together.
  3. Moving Window Locks: These locks are utilized on horizontal sliding windows and generally feature a latch or a locking bar that protects the window in place.
  4. Awning Locks: Similar to casement locks, awning locks are used on windows that open outside from the bottom and secure the window to the frame.
  5. Security Bars: Reinforced bars that can be set up on the outside of windows to offer additional defense versus required entry.
  6. Secret Locks and Deadbolts: These are more robust locking mechanisms that can be set up on any type of window and require a crucial to open.
  7. Electronic Locks: Advanced locks that use electronic components like sensing units and keypads, typically incorporated with home security systems.

Tips for Homeowners

  1. Conduct Regular Inspections: Regularly inspect your windows for any indications of wear or damage. Loose frames, broken glass, and worn-out locks can all jeopardize your home's security.
  2. Purchase High-Quality Locks: Opt for locks made by reputable manufacturers that are known for their sturdiness and dependability.
  3. Think About Multiple Layers of Security: Combine various kinds of window locks with other security measures like motion sensors and security cameras for a more robust system.
  4. Inform Your Family: Ensure that all relative know how to effectively use and keep the window locks. This includes teaching them to lock windows when they are not in usage.
  5. Stay Informed About Security Trends: Keep up-to-date with the most current security technologies and patterns. New innovations can use enhanced security for your home.
